EEG Technologist (R.EEG T.)
The Neuvera Brain Health Institute (BHI) is seeking a skilled and dedicated Registered EEG Technologist (R.EEG T.) to join our team. In this full-time role (40 hrs./week), you will be responsible for performing high-quality EEG studies, ensuring patient comfort, and supporting our clinical and research operations. Candidates must hold an active R.EEG T. credential and have prior experience in neurology.
Requirements
Key Responsibilities
-
Set up patients and subjects for scalp-based EEG recordings while following ASET and ACNS guidelines
-
Ensure all electrodes and sensors for EEG, ECG, and other related signals are correctly placed according to standards and securely attached to provide maximum patient comfort and optimal signal clarity
-
Safely disconnect patients and subjects, properly clean electrodes, sensors, and equipment according to Neuvera policy and procedures
-
Communicate efficiently and professionally with patients and subjects, family members, and care givers to answer questions and explain the EEG procedure and services provided by the Neuvera BHI
-
Confirm all EEG and digital video files are uploaded to the NeuroMatch system
-
Verify all patient and subject information, questionnaires, and forms are completed by the patient and uploaded to the NeuroMatch system
-
Maintain EEG systems, computers, cameras, electrodes, sensors, and ancillary equipment utilized to record patient information
-
Verify all supplies and accessories are available for each recording
-
Coordinate scheduling and management of procedures to ensure compliance with Neuvera BHI’s daily caseload plan
-
Maintain, update, and follow Neuvera BHI Policy & Procedure manual
-
Support the clinical, technical, administrative, research, and affiliated teams as assigned
-
Support Neuvera business partners as assigned
-
Follow all HIPAA regulations and requirements
-
Follow and uphold Neuvera BHI clinic policies, compliance guidelines, confidentiality, and code of conduct requirements
-
Perform additional duties as assigned
